腾讯云代理商:使用腾讯云负载均衡时,如何管理多台服务器的流量?
一、腾讯云负载均衡的核心优势
腾讯云负载均衡(Cloud Load Balancer, CLB)作为分布式流量分发的核心服务,具备以下关键优势:
- 高可用性保障:通过跨可用区部署和健康检查机制,自动剔除异常服务器,确保服务不中断。
- 弹性扩展能力:动态适配业务流量变化,支持秒级添加/移除后端服务器,无需手动调整配置。
- 智能化流量分配:提供加权轮询、最小连接数等多种算法,优化资源利用率。
- 全协议支持:覆盖HTTP/HTTPS/TCP/UDP等协议,满足Web应用、游戏、IoT等多种场景需求。
二、多服务器流量管理的关键步骤
1. 后端服务器组的配置与管理
在腾讯云控制台或通过API创建服务器组时需注意:
- 服务器权重设置:根据服务器性能差异分配不同权重(如高性能服务器权重为100,低配设为50)。
- 健康检查参数:建议设置响应超时时间为5秒,检查间隔30秒,连续失败3次标记为异常。
- 跨可用区部署:将服务器分散在不同可用区(如上海Zone A和Zone B),避免单点故障。
2. 监听器的精细化设置
监听类型 | 适用场景 | 配置建议 |
---|---|---|
HTTP/HTTPS | Web应用、API服务 | 启用SNI支持多域名证书,配置URL转发规则 |
TCP/UDP | 数据库访问、实时通信 | 设置连接保持时间(如TCP保持300秒) |
3. 高级流量调度策略
腾讯云CLB提供进阶功能:
- 基于地域的流量调度:通过Anycast技术实现用户就近接入,降低延迟。
- 会话保持(Sticky Session):对于需要状态保持的应用,可开启Cookie或IP hash保持。
- 安全防护集成:与WAF、DDoS高防联动,在流量分发同时过滤恶意请求。
三、实战场景优化方案
案例1:电商大促期间的突发流量处理
解决方案:
- 预先配置弹性伸缩组(Auto Scaling),设定CPU利用率超过70%自动扩容
- 在CLB中启用"最小连接数"算法,避免部分服务器过载
- 通过内容分发网络(CDN)缓存静态资源,减少后端压力
案例2:全球业务的多地域部署
操作流程:
- 在东京、法兰克福等地域分别部署服务器集群
- 使用全球应用加速(GAAP)结合CLB实现智能DNS解析
- 设置健康检查跨国专线,探测延时<150ms
四、常见问题排查指南
- Q: 部分服务器未接收到请求?
- - 检查安全组规则是否开放对应端口
- 验证健康检查配置是否符合应用响应特征 - Q: 如何实现蓝绿部署?
- 1. 创建两个独立的后端服务器组(v1和v2)
2. 通过监听器权重逐步切换流量(100:0 → 50:50 → 0:100)
总结
腾讯云负载均衡为代理商提供了企业级的流量管理解决方案,通过灵活的后端服务器配置、智能调度算法和深度云产品集成,能有效应对从中小型企业到大型互联网平台的各种流量分发需求。建议结合腾讯云监控服务实时关注关键指标(如QPS、平均延时),并定期进行压测验证系统承载能力。对于复杂场景,可联系腾讯云架构师团队获取定制化方案。